If this aligns with your values and you want to join a leader in the banking industry, we are hiring for an EFT Specialist II that will be responsible for processing Electronic Payments while meeting department standards, objectives, and maintaining excellent customer service. Resolves more complex transactions identified in exception queues. Independently works through problem resolutions with minimal supervision. Also performs operational support and administrative duties.
MAJOR DUTIES/ACCOUNTABILITIES
• Processes and verifies payments denominated in USD and Foreign Currency.
• Resolves all exception items identified in Stopped Incoming, Unsent Domestic, and Unsent International workflows.
• Validates the authenticity of outgoing payment request.
• Reverses all incoming transactions with ambiguous or missing information.
• Resolves all EFT inquires/investigations as received from partner banks by phone or email.
• Reviews and decisions rejected wires.
• Checks SWIFT Terminal for new messages.
• Processes Third-Party Service Provider Drawdown Settlements.
• Prepares DDA and Prologue GL entries for posting.
• Performs End-of-Day and ACH Reconcilement.
• Processes Foreign Exchange products.
• Maintains knowledge of applicable regulations, policies, and procedures.
• Complies with all banking laws and regulations and maintains the confidentiality of bank and customer information.
